Pros

Can be very good pay if you can sell.. but read below. Systems are top notch

Cons

Integrity Express recently overhauled their commission structure to cut commissions by 25% and limits commission on past customers, current or not, by a 38% decrease if you can resell those. Ask management about this during your interview. They are not done cutting/restructuring commissions. Potential new customers with any impact are relatively maxed out - they'll show you the razzle dazzle of the top performers but that is not realistic for new hires. Prepare for an underwhelming training program and with a "stick rate" close to 10%.. thats right. For every 10 sales people hired about 1 will make it to the commission level. Day starts at 0600 in Denver until 1500 Very loose work environment - like a frat house

Pros

Food truck days, happy hours, fun Christmas party (which doesn't exist anymore).

Cons

I used to come home and cry every other day after working here. If you didn't come in early, work late, skip your lunch, and work weekends management would make veiled threats about creating a mandatory overtime policy. You may even get looked at sideways if you went to the bathroom one too many times or spent too long in there. Management is very gossipy. It is a frat house like atmosphere. If you are a woman who is attractive, expect to be sexually harassed. I almost switched careers because this was my first corporate job and I thought that every place was like IEL. And I put up with all of this just to get a paycheck making less than minimum wage after health insurance premiums were taken out of my check.
